图书介绍
MATLAB 7.0实用宝典【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

- 景振毅,张泽兵,董霖编著 著
- 出版社: 北京:中国铁道出版社
- ISBN:9787113094263
- 出版时间:2009
- 标注页数:586页
- 文件大小:149MB
- 文件页数:606页
- 主题词:计算机辅助计算-软件包,MATLAB 7.0
PDF下载
下载说明
MATLAB 7.0实用宝典P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第一篇 基础篇2
第1章 MATLAB入门2
1.1 MATLAB简介2
1.1.1 MATLAB的特点和优势2
1.1.2 版本升级3
1.2 安装与卸载3
1.3 主界面6
1.3.1 命令窗口(Command Window)6
1.3.2 其他窗口9
1.3.3 菜单栏、工具栏和开始按钮14
1.4 搜索路径17
1.5 帮助系统19
1.6 小结24
第2章 MATLAB矩阵和数组25
2.1 矩阵的创建25
2.1.1 直接输入元素创建矩阵25
2.1.2 调用函数创建特殊矩阵26
2.2 矩阵间的连接28
2.2.1 基本连接28
2.2.2 函数连接30
2.3 矩阵的扩展32
2.3.1 扩大矩阵的尺寸32
2.3.2 缩小矩阵的尺寸33
2.4 改变矩阵的形状33
2.5 向量、标量与空矩阵35
2.5.1 向量35
2.5.2 标量37
2.5.3 空矩阵38
2.6 矩阵元素的寻访39
2.6.1 双下标寻访39
2.6.2 单下标寻访39
2.6.3 寻访多个元素41
2.7 矩阵信息的获取42
2.7.1 获取矩阵的数据结构43
2.7.2 获取矩阵元素的数据类型43
2.7.3 获取矩阵的尺寸信息45
2.8 高维数组46
2.8.1 高维数组的创建46
2.8.2 高维数组的信息访问48
2.8.3 高维数组操作函数49
2.9 小结52
第3章 MATLAB数据类型53
3.1 数值类型53
3.1.1 整数类型53
3.1.2 双精度浮点类型55
3.1.3 单精度浮点类型57
3.1.4 复数58
3.1.5 无穷和非数60
3.2 逻辑类型62
3.2.1 创建逻辑类型63
3.2.2 逻辑矩阵的应用63
3.3 字符与字符串64
3.3.1 创建字符数组64
3.3.2 字符串的比较66
3.3.3 字符串的查找与替换68
3.3.4 字符串与数值类型的互相转换68
3.4 元胞69
3.4.1 创建元胞数组69
3.4.2 字符串元胞数组72
3.4.3 访问元胞数组内容73
3.5 构架74
3.5.1 创建构架数组74
3.5.2 访问构架数组元素76
3.6 小结77
第4章 MATLAB数值运算78
4.1 矩阵基本运算78
4.1.1 矩阵的加/减78
4.1.2 矩阵乘法79
4.1.3 矩阵除法80
4.1.4 矩阵的幂82
4.1.5 矩阵按位运算83
4.2 关系运算与逻辑运算86
4.2.1 关系运算符86
4.2.2 逻辑运算符88
4.2.3 关系逻辑函数90
4.3 运算符优先级91
4.4 小结92
第5章 绘图93
5.1 MATLAB绘图功能概述93
5.2 基本绘图指令94
5.2.1 基本绘图流程94
5.2.2 常用绘图函数95
5.2.3 线型设置98
5.2.4 多图绘制100
5.2.5 坐标格式设置101
5.3 图形标注103
5.3.1 图形标注概述104
5.3.2 图形标题105
5.3.3 坐标轴标签106
5.3.4 图例设置107
5.3.5 文本的标注108
5.3.6 封闭区域的填充110
5.4 模式化绘图111
5.4.1 柱状图和面积图111
5.4.2 饼图113
5.4.3 直方图113
5.4.4 离散数据绘图115
5.4.5 等高线图116
5.4.6 向量图117
5.4.7 函数绘图119
5.5 三维绘图120
5.5.1 三维图形概述120
5.5.2 三维基本绘图121
5.5.3 三维模式化绘图125
5.5.4 三维图显示控制131
5.6 小结141
第二篇 提高篇144
第6章 图形对象和句柄144
6.1 MATLAB图形对象144
6.1.1 图形对象的体系结构144
6.1.2 根对象145
6.1.3 图形窗口对象(Figure)145
6.1.4 用户界面对象(UI Objects)145
6.1.5 轴对象(Axes)146
6.1.6 内核对象(Core Objects)146
6.1.7 绘图对象(Plot Objects)147
6.1.8 组对象(Group Objects)147
6.1.9 注释对象(Annotation Objects)147
6.1.10 MATLAB图形对象的属性148
6.2 MATLAB对象句柄148
6.2.1 MATLAB对象句柄的概念148
6.2.2 对象句柄的寻访149
6.2.3 使用句柄操作对象150
6.3 设置和查询对象属性151
6.3.1 设置对象属性152
6.3.2 查询对象属性152
6.3.3 对象默认属性154
6.4 图形窗口对象(Figure)157
6.4.1 窗口对象的位置属性157
6.4.2 窗口对象的色彩属性158
6.4.3 窗口对象的绘制模式159
6.4.4 定制图形窗口的光标159
6.5 轴对象(Axes)160
6.5.1 轴对象的位置属性160
6.5.2 轴对象的刻度、刻度标记及坐标轴方向161
6.5.3 轴对象的多轴重叠163
6.5.4 轴对象的自动模式属性165
6.6 图形输出控制165
6.6.1 定制图形输出的窗口和轴165
6.6.2 利用newPlot属性定制图形输出的重叠属性165
6.7 小结167
第7章 程序设计168
7.1 M文件168
7.1.1 M文件编辑器168
7.1.2 脚本文件(MATLAB scripts)和函数文件(MATLAB functions)169
7.1.3 M文件结构175
7.1.4 P-码文件176
7.2 函数177
7.2.1 主函数与子函数177
7.2.2 嵌套函数179
7.3 变量182
7.3.1 变量的命名规则182
7.3.2 变量的分类183
7.3.3 变量检测函数185
7.4 程序结构186
7.4.1 顺序结构187
7.4.2 循环结构187
7.4.3 分支结构191
7.5 程序控制语句195
7.5.1 结束循环语句195
7.5.2 错误警告语句198
7.5.3 输入控制语句200
7.6 小结202
第8章 程序调试、优化和出错处理203
8.1 调试203
8.1.1 调试的基本任务203
8.1.2 程序调试的基本方法206
8.1.3 MATLAB调试器207
8.1.4 警告和错误信息211
8.2 性能优化212
8.2.1 MATLAB性能分析212
8.2.2 效率优化技术216
8.2.3 内存优化技术216
8.3 出错处理217
8.3.1 错误查询机制217
8.3.2 错误处理218
8.4 小结220
第9章 MATLAB符号计算221
9.1 符号对象的创建221
9.1.1 创建符号变量和常量221
9.1.2 创建符号表达式223
9.1.3 创建符号矩阵224
9.1.4 创建符号函数224
9.1.5 解析型对象到数值型对象的转换225
9.2 符号表达式操作227
9.2.1 符号表达式的展开、分解及化简227
9.2.2 符号表达式的替换231
9.3 符号函数操作233
9.3.1 符号函数复合233
9.3.2 符号函数求反234
9.3.3 特殊符号函数235
9.4 符号矩阵操作235
9.4.1 符号矩阵的代数运算235
9.4.2 符号矩阵的逻辑运算238
9.4.3 符号矩阵的行列式238
9.4.4 符号矩阵的逆239
9.4.5 符号矩阵的秩240
9.4.6 符号矩阵的特征分解241
9.4.7 符号矩阵的SVD分解243
9.5 符号微积分245
9.5.1 符号极限245
9.5.2 符号微分246
9.5.3 符号积分248
9.5.4 符号级数展开250
9.5.5 符号级数求和251
9.6 符号方程求解252
9.6.1 一般代数方程252
9.6.2 线性代数方程组254
9.6.3 符号常微分方程256
9.7 小结259
第三篇 应用篇262
第10章 数据分析262
10.1 数据排序分析262
10.1.1 最大(小)值262
10.1.2 中位数、分位数264
10.1.3 排序266
10.2 数据求和(积)、差分269
10.2.1 求和269
10.2.2 求积270
10.2.3 求累计和、积271
10.2.4 差分272
10.3 均值和方差分析272
10.4 数据预处理274
10.4.1 缺失数据处理274
10.4.2 异常值274
10.5 统计分析276
10.5.1 几种重要的概率分布276
10.5.2 随机数的生成277
10.5.3 数据直方图分析279
10.5.4 数据统计函数281
10.6 小结283
第11章 矩阵分析284
11.1 矩阵分析的应用背景284
11.1.1 线性代数方程求解284
11.1.2 最优化问题285
11.2 矩阵特征量285
11.2.1 矩阵的行列式285
11.2.2 矩阵的逆286
11.2.3 矩阵的范数288
11.2.4 矩阵的条件数290
11.2.5 矩阵的秩292
11.2.6 矩阵特征值294
11.3 矩阵分解295
11.3.1 特征值分解296
11.3.2 Schur分解297
11.3.3 Cholesky分解298
11.3.4 LU分解299
11.3.5 QR分解302
11.3.6 SVD分解303
11.4 矩阵函数306
11.4.1 矩阵函数的概念306
11.4.2 常用矩阵函数306
11.4.3 用户定义矩阵函数308
11.5 小结310
第12章 函数分析311
12.1 函数的表示311
12.1.1 匿名函数311
12.1.2 M函数文件312
12.1.3 匿名函数与M函数文件比较313
12.1.4 函数句柄314
12.2 函数的零点314
12.2.1 问题描述314
12.2.2 初始区间法求函数零点314
12.2.3 初始点法求函数零点316
12.3 数值积分318
12.3.1 单重积分318
12.3.2 多重积分321
12.4 数值微分323
12.4.1 数值差分与一元数值微分323
12.4.2 数值梯度与多元数值微分325
12.5 函数最优化326
12.5.1 单变量最优化326
12.5.2 多变量最优化328
12.6 函数可视化330
12.6.1 MATLAB函数可视化函数330
12.6.2 一元函数可视化330
12.6.3 二元函数可视化332
12.6.4 极坐标图334
12.7 小结335
第13章 高级数值计算336
13.1 多项式336
13.1.1 多项式表示336
13.1.2 矩阵特征多项式336
13.1.3 多项式求值337
13.1.4 多项式的根338
13.1.5 多项式卷积和反卷积339
13.1.6 多项式微积分340
13.1.7 有理分式部分和展开341
13.2 插值342
13.2.1 一维插值342
13.2.2 二维插值345
13.2.3 插值方法346
13.3 回归分析和曲线拟合350
13.3.1 问题描述350
13.3.2 线性回归分析350
13.3.3 多分量回归分析353
13.3.4 曲线拟合354
13.3.5 交互式曲线拟合工具356
13.4 傅里叶分析358
13.4.1 FFT和IFFT358
13.4.2 FFT的幅度和相位360
13.4.3 傅里叶分析应用实例361
13.5 常微分方程363
13.5.1 一阶常微分方程363
13.5.2 高阶常微分方程367
13.5.3 ODE函数的选择369
13.6 小结371
第14章 用户图形界面(GUI)372
14.1 两种GUI设计方式372
14.1.1 GUI对象及层次结构373
14.1.2 回调函数374
14.1.3 手工代码式375
14.1.4 GUIDE式378
14.1.5 GUIDE界面环境382
14.2 GUI界面设计386
14.2.1 界面设计原则386
14.2.2 窗口和轴388
14.2.3 菜单388
14.2.4 控件390
14.3 GUI程序设计391
14.3.1 GUIM文件结构剖析391
14.3.2 GUIDE的数据组织392
14.3.3 回调函数393
14.4 GUI应用实例394
14.4.1 用户需求395
14.4.2 GUI界面设计395
14.4.3 GUI程序设计396
14.4.4 GUI程序发布397
14.5 小结397
第四篇 接口篇400
第15章 文件的I/O操作400
15.1 低级文件的打开和关闭400
15.2 读取和写入ASCII文件401
15.2.1 ASCII文件的读取401
15.2.2 ASCII文件的写入404
15.3 读取和写入二进制文件405
15.3.1 二进制文件的读取405
15.3.2 二进制文件的写入406
15.4 文件位置指针407
15.5 高级文件I/O操作409
15.6 小结413
第16章 MATLAB编译器414
16.1 MATLAB编译器简介414
16.1.1 MATLAB Compiler 4414
16.1.2 MATLAB Compiler 4的功能和局限性416
16.2 安装与设置416
16.2.1 编译器的安装416
16.2.2 MCR的安装417
16.2.3 编译器的设置418
16.3 编译器的使用419
16.3.1 MCC选项419
16.3.2 编译指令421
16.3.3 独立于MATLAB环境的M程序编译422
16.4 编译器的独立应用422
16.4.1 独立C/C++应用的创建423
16.4.2 独立Windows应用程序的创建423
16.4.3 独立应用程序的发布425
16.5 小结426
第17章 应用程序接口427
17.1 mxArray数据结构427
17.2 mx函数428
17.3 MATLAB中调用C和FORTRAN429
17.3.1 MEX文件简介429
17.3.2 MEX配置430
17.3.3 C语言MEX文件432
17.3.4 FORTRAN语言MEX文件433
17.4 MATLAB引擎434
17.4.1 C语言引擎函数435
17.4.2 FORTRAN语言引擎函数439
17.4.3 引擎应用实例441
17.5 C和FORTRAN调用MATLAB445
17.5.1 由M程序创建共享函数库(DLL)445
17.5.2 C/FORTRAN中调用MATLAB446
17.5.3 应用实例446
17.6 小结449
第18章 Notebook和M-book450
18.1 M-book450
18.1.1 Notebook的安装和设置450
18.1.2 创建M-book451
18.2 细胞453
18.2.1 细胞和细胞群453
18.2.2 自初始化细胞455
18.2.3 计算区456
18.2.4 细胞的循环运行459
18.2.5 输出细胞的格式控制460
18.2.6 Notebook使用注意462
18.3 小结463
第五篇 工具箱篇466
第19章 信号处理工具箱466
19.1 波形产生466
19.1.1 常用周期信号466
19.1.2 常用非周期信号467
19.1.3 常用序列469
19.2 IIR滤波器设计471
19.2.1 滤波器原型设计471
19.2.2 频率指标转换475
19.2.3 离散化477
19.2.4 直接IIR滤波器设计479
19.3 FIR滤波器设计482
19.3.1 窗口方法设计483
19.3.2 多带FIR滤波器设计484
19.3.3 约束最小二乘法设计487
19.3.4 任意响应滤波器设计489
19.4 频谱分析490
19.4.1 周期图方法490
19.4.2 Welch方法493
19.4.3 MTM和MUSIC方法494
19.4.4 参数化方法497
19.5 使用SPTool500
19.5.1 功能概述500
19.5.2 数据的导入501
19.5.3 信号查看503
19.5.4 滤波器设计504
19.5.5 滤波器查看507
19.5.6 频谱查看509
19.6 小结511
第20章 图像处理工具箱512
20.1 数字图像基础512
20.1.1 数字图像的生成512
20.1.2 图像数据的读/写514
20.1.3 图像数据的显示515
20.2 MATLAB图像类型517
20.2.1 四种常见的图像类型517
20.2.2 图像类型的相互转换518
20.3 图像的灰度变换522
20.3.1 图像的直方图523
20.3.2 灰度变换524
20.3.3 直方图均衡527
20.4 图像的代数运算528
20.4.1 图像加法529
20.4.2 图像乘法529
20.4.3 图像减法530
20.4.4 图像除法530
20.5 图像的几何运算530
20.5.1 图像缩放531
20.5.2 图像旋转532
20.5.3 图像裁剪534
20.6 图像滤波534
20.6.1 卷积和相关534
20.6.2 线性滤波536
20.6.3 排序滤波539
20.7 小结541
第21章 SIMULINK工具箱542
21.1 SIMULINK基础知识542
21.1.1 安装SIMULINK542
21.1.2 启动SIMULINK543
21.1.3 SIMULINK库浏览器544
21.1.4 模型窗口菜单栏545
21.1.5 模型窗口工具栏和状态栏547
21.1.6 SIMULINK简单建模仿真示例548
21.1.7 SIMULINK帮助550
21.2 模块操作552
21.2.1 连接模块552
21.2.2 模块参数设置553
21.2.3 信号标签555
21.2.4 信号标签的传递555
21.3 仿真设置557
21.3.1 设置仿真时间558
21.3.2 设置仿真步长558
21.3.3 设置仿真算法559
21.3.4 设置输出选项561
21.4 连续系统模型实现562
21.4.1 连续系统数学描述562
21.4.2 连续系统模型实例566
21.5 SIMULINK子系统568
21.5.1 子系统的创建569
21.5.2 子系统的封装571
21.6 编写S-函数575
21.6.1 S-函数的工作原理575
21.6.2 S-函数的概念576
21.6.3 S-函数的使用578
21.6.4 S-函数模板581
21.6.5 S-函数举例583
21.7 小结586
热门推荐
- 3652825.html
- 3783172.html
- 964195.html
- 1856284.html
- 1453152.html
- 3112048.html
- 3323811.html
- 2858570.html
- 337765.html
- 362729.html
- http://www.ickdjs.cc/book_1301830.html
- http://www.ickdjs.cc/book_799458.html
- http://www.ickdjs.cc/book_3275887.html
- http://www.ickdjs.cc/book_971009.html
- http://www.ickdjs.cc/book_2004272.html
- http://www.ickdjs.cc/book_1151598.html
- http://www.ickdjs.cc/book_1292232.html
- http://www.ickdjs.cc/book_1256230.html
- http://www.ickdjs.cc/book_1595159.html
- http://www.ickdjs.cc/book_2074108.html